hello Steve7481,
Quote:
Is there a way I can install my hard drive using the extra SATA cable I have?
Just wondering how many SATA connections do u have on ur MotherBoard?
2? if u have 1 free then u can do this

I connected my Old IDE connector HD to a Sata connection(On my motherboard) using an IDE conversion to Sata device, i got this from Frys electronics for like 5$.

Anyway this device connects to the back of the HD with an IDE connector and then on the front of this device u connect the Sata cable to it and the motherboard and of course u power the HD on this device and thats it, i hope i didn't write this so it sounds more complicated then it is, it is really simple to do.

@Steve

Go to Dell's site and get your manual. If you're connecting with IDE your drives should probably be connected with the jumpers set to "cable select" (end of cable, Master; and Slave, to middle of cable) all jumpers set to cable select.
